The goal of the International Monument Photography Experience (EFIM) is to encourage students to take a look at their cultural heritage. The competition aims to establish a dialogue between European youth and their surroundings, using photography as a means for creating a digital image of the real world we inhabit.

This catalogue is the result of this experience, offering a framework for the global collaboration that exists between the world’s many countries and regions. Ten of the selected images here are frm Castilla-La Mancha. Their presence is the final result of a process in which more than 1000 young people participated—including residents of Albacete, Ciudad Real, Cuenca, Guadalajara and Toledo.
